## LiteLLM versions of the OpenAI Exception Types
from openai import (
AuthenticationError,
BadRequestError,
NotFoundError,
RateLimitError,
APIStatusError,
OpenAIError,
APIError,
APITimeoutError,
APIConnectionError,
APIResponseValidationError,
UnprocessableEntityError,
)
import httpx
class AuthenticationError(AuthenticationError): # type: ignore
def __init__(self, message, llm_provider, model, response: httpx.Response):
self.status_code = 401
self.message = message
self.llm_provider = llm_provider
self.model = model
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
# raise when invalid models passed, example gpt-8
class NotFoundError(NotFoundError): # type: ignore
def __init__(self, message, model, llm_provider, response: httpx.Response):
self.status_code = 404
self.message = message
self.model = model
self.llm_provider = llm_provider
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
class BadRequestError(BadRequestError): # type: ignore
def __init__(self, message, model, llm_provider, response: httpx.Response):
self.status_code = 400
self.message = message
self.model = model
self.llm_provider = llm_provider
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
class UnprocessableEntityError(UnprocessableEntityError): # type: ignore
def __init__(self, message, model, llm_provider, response: httpx.Response):
self.status_code = 422
self.message = message
self.model = model
self.llm_provider = llm_provider
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
class Timeout(APITimeoutError): # type: ignore
def __init__(self, message, model, llm_provider):
self.status_code = 408
self.message = message
self.model = model
self.llm_provider = llm_provider
request = httpx.Request(method="POST", url="https://api.openai.com/v1")
super().__init__(
request=request
) # Call the base class constructor with the parameters it needs
class RateLimitError(RateLimitError): # type: ignore
def __init__(self, message, llm_provider, model, response: httpx.Response):
self.status_code = 429
self.message = message
self.llm_provider = llm_provider
self.modle = model
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
# sub class of rate limit error - meant to give more granularity for error handling context window exceeded errors
class ContextWindowExceededError(BadRequestError): # type: ignore
def __init__(self, message, model, llm_provider, response: httpx.Response):
self.status_code = 400
self.message = message
self.model = model
self.llm_provider = llm_provider
super().__init__(
message=self.message,
model=self.model, # type: ignore
llm_provider=self.llm_provider, # type: ignore
response=response,
) # Call the base class constructor with the parameters it needs
class ContentPolicyViolationError(BadRequestError): # type: ignore
# Error code: 400 - {'error': {'code': 'content_policy_violation', 'message': 'Your request was rejected as a result of our safety system. Image descriptions generated from your prompt may contain text that is not allowed by our safety system. If you believe this was done in error, your request may succeed if retried, or by adjusting your prompt.', 'param': None, 'type': 'invalid_request_error'}}
def __init__(self, message, model, llm_provider, response: httpx.Response):
self.status_code = 400
self.message = message
self.model = model
self.llm_provider = llm_provider
super().__init__(
message=self.message,
model=self.model, # type: ignore
llm_provider=self.llm_provider, # type: ignore
response=response,
) # Call the base class constructor with the parameters it needs
class ServiceUnavailableError(APIStatusError): # type: ignore
def __init__(self, message, llm_provider, model, response: httpx.Response):
self.status_code = 503
self.message = message
self.llm_provider = llm_provider
self.model = model
super().__init__(
self.message, response=response, body=None
) # Call the base class constructor with the parameters it needs
# raise this when the API returns an invalid response object - https://github.com/openai/openai-python/blob/1be14ee34a0f8e42d3f9aa5451aa4cb161f1781f/openai/api_requestor.py#L401
class APIError(APIError): # type: ignore
def __init__(
self, status_code, message, llm_provider, model, request: httpx.Request
):
self.status_code = status_code
self.message = message
self.llm_provider = llm_provider
self.model = model
super().__init__(self.message, request=request, body=None) # type: ignore
# raised if an invalid request (not get, delete, put, post) is made
class APIConnectionError(APIConnectionError): # type: ignore
def __init__(self, message, llm_provider, model, request: httpx.Request):
self.message = message
self.llm_provider = llm_provider
self.model = model
self.status_code = 500
super().__init__(message=self.message, request=request)
# raised if an invalid request (not get, delete, put, post) is made
class APIResponseValidationError(APIResponseValidationError): # type: ignore
def __init__(self, message, llm_provider, model):
self.message = message
self.llm_provider = llm_provider
self.model = model
request = httpx.Request(method="POST", url="https://api.openai.com/v1")
response = httpx.Response(status_code=500, request=request)
super().__init__(response=response, body=None, message=message)
class OpenAIError(OpenAIError): # type: ignore
def __init__(self, original_exception):
self.status_code = original_exception.http_status
super().__init__(
http_body=original_exception.http_body,
http_status=original_exception.http_status,
json_body=original_exception.json_body,
headers=original_exception.headers,
code=original_exception.code,
)
self.llm_provider = "openai"
class BudgetExceededError(Exception):
def __init__(self, current_cost, max_budget):
self.current_cost = current_cost
self.max_budget = max_budget
message = f"Budget has been exceeded! Current cost: {current_cost}, Max budget: {max_budget}"
super().__init__(message)
